Upcoming free activities in the Ottawa area

Facebooktwittermail

 

  • Salsa babies is an activity for families and children of all ages held at Jean Pigott Place every Tuesday until August 18th from 10 am to noon. It’s a great opportunity to introduce your children to music and dance
  • Circus Jam is an activity for families and children (supervision required) held at Marion Dewar Plaza every Tuesday until August 25th from 7 to 9 pm
  • Zumba in the park on July 30th from 6:30 to 8 pm at Mousette Park in Hull
  • The Ottawa International Chamber Music Festival presents their Bring the Kids! series of 3 free shows for the whole family held at City Hall
  • The movie HOME will be presented at Westboro Beach (Kitchissipi Lookout) Friday July 31st at dusk and the movie BOX TROLLS will be presented Friday August 14 th at Heritage park in Orleans at dusk as part of the Friday Night Flicks
  • Casino Lac Leamy Sound of Light Festival will start August 8th at the museum of history with fireworks & performances on August 8th, 12th, 15th & 22nd. The onsite admission is 8$ per person and free for children under the age of 11 and it is also possible to still see the fireworks even if not onsite.
  • Agwata is a free 15 minute long multimedia watershow presented every evening until August 2nd at 9:30 pm, 10 pm & 10:30 pm. The location of the watershow is at the Ruisseau de la Brasserie on Hanson Street in Gatineau
  • Ottawa International Buskerfest will be held from July 30th to August 3rd on Sparks Streets in Ottawa. This years edition features over 150 outdoor shows, a bouncy castle as well as the circus school
  • Changing of the guard is held everyday at 10 am until August 21st on Parliament Hill
  • The Sound and light show on Parliament Hill is held every evening until September 12th 2015 at 10 pm in July, 9:30 pm in August and 9 pm in September
